If you knowingly and illegally falsify medical records to get a favor, such as if a patient gives you bribes to falsify their medical records, you can be charged with a crime in court. The possible penalty for this is usually a maximum of five years in prison or a fine of 162,500.

Can you have something removed from your medical record? HIPAA doesnt actually allow people to correct their medical records instead, it provides people with a right to amend the record by adding in additional information. But if a person wants to remove erroneous information, that person is generally out of luck.
